Chae, Sang-Hyeop: referee stats

Chae, Sang-Hyeop (South Korea) has shown 2.23 cards per game in 53 analysed matches — −27% compared with the average of the same leagues. Profile: very lenient.

How the numbers are calculated

Cards = yellow and red cards shown to players during 90 minutes (a second yellow counts as a yellow plus a red, as most bookmakers settle). Cards for coaches and substitutes on the bench and cards in extra time are excluded. Penalties = penalties awarded during the match (shoot-outs excluded). “vs league” compares the referee with the average of the exact league seasons this referee worked, so a referee from a card-heavy league is not called strict just because of the league.

Data: official match events and statistics (API-Sports), updated daily.
